Advances in earth observation of global change [electronic resource] / edited by Emilio Chuvieco, Jonathan Li, Xiaojun Yang.
Global Change studies are increasingly being considered a vital source of information to understand the Earth Environment, in particular in the framework of human-induced climate change and land use transformation.
